For their 8th year, the Champagne Academy of Irish Dance will be performing and hosting the Ireland booth at Summer of the Arts on June 3rd in downtown Iowa City. The school opened then very first Ireland booth in 2010 in the infancy of SOTA’s “Global Village”. Children receive a passport, then “travel” to different countries, all hosted by local community groups, where they learn about each represented country and make a craft or participate in an activity.
The Ireland booth will feature crafts, learn about Irish music and language, Irish dance demonstrations, and free mini-lessons. The Champagne Academy is very involved with this community event, and in addition to hosting the Ireland booth, they will do a formal performance on the family stage.
